see credits lie behind these discover new adventures and 360 degrees. and explore fascinating. both heritage dw world heritage 360. now the phase specially purpose design and female crash test dummy is vital. the . since the invention of cars, we've had car crashes, and while cars have become safer over time, there's an unsettling truth. in the event of a crash statistic show, women are more likely to be killed or seriously injured then man. but why?
5:31 am
crash test dummies are not just the cheesy ninety's band. they're the unsung heroes of the automotive world, taking in place hits to make our roads safer. but these rubber superstars have a secret. they were built for man. and ms. bias effects the safety of every woman behind the wheel. regulatory test says we use, it says that you have to use the model of an average may. and the simplest today are women are in the front seat. in fact, they're in the driver seat, and we need to reflect that in our testing protocol to have women in the driver seat. and every moment that we wait, we're jeopardizing another mother, sister daughter. exploring the evolution from the early days of crash test to cutting edge technology in today's crash test dummies. we delve into f fritz by
5:32 am
engineers to rectify gender bias in car safety. for us, for everybody here as the approach is to make the road traffic safer for everybody crash test dummies have played a crucial role in improving car safety and revolutionizing the way we design and test vehicles. since we've had crash tests, car safety has developed and improved with the crash test dummies is the pioneer and it's the basis for which all crash safety equipment is measured. so every vehicle when you talk about criminal zones, and you talk about advance features like automatic braking and re different types of restraints, including the airbag and the seat belt and pre tensioners, they're all modeled and based on the crest as dummy. we know thanks to these lights less wonders, but there's a catch. they were mainly created with man in mind. and the initial domains represented the average man is the young. currently,
5:33 am
we cannot assess the safety for both part of the population in 1980, the base dummy, the hybrid 3550, became the basis for with all testing and that's used. and the majority of all testing requirements worldwide, which used in the driver's seat is used in other positions. and it was based on the average male size with the idea that the male drove. so he was in the driver seat and safety testing directly affects car design. this has a big impact. here are some horrifying facts. us data has shown as a woman, you're a 17 percent more likely to die in a car crash and 73 percent more likely to be seriously injured than a man in the same vehicle. when we looked at crass test, what's called the and have the crash test ratings for cars. i as do most people say
5:34 am
that they are also being represented for women who by the way, drive more than men these days. in the mid 20th century, as cars became more popular and accidents increased manufacturers driven by safety concerns and government interest looked for ways to enhance safety records. the us took the lead to forming the national highway traffic safety administration in $197819.00 seventies. we started using crash test dummies at that time, there was a loyal to a male 5 being a male, suzy. so they only tested for a minute and a few of them could 19 seventies really became the emergence of the more modern and crushed test time. he had started with the hybrid 2 and then advanced to the hybrid 3, which is really noticed the moderns crest estimate. the hybrid 3 is the industry standard for frontal crash testing and mirrors, the average 50th percentile, man in height and weight. i the median. a percentile indicates the height and
5:35 am
weight compared to the rest of the population. for example, a 95th percentile dummy would represent a man and the 95th percentile for body dimensions, which means that he's larger than 95 percent of man in the population. equipped with articulated joints and sensors, it records data on forces accelerations and injury criteria serving as a crucial tool in replicating human biomechanics. but there is a problem the 50, as well as the primary workforce. the primary to always use from 1982 today, it's still the primary use of tool, and we're going on 40 to 50 years of use of this dummy that has limited sensors, old technology. the 2nd most used crash test dummies is the 5th percentile, which is a scale down version of the 50th percentile man had
5:36 am
a height of 152 centimeters and weight of 50 killers. in the ninety's, we realize that we didn't have a female crash test dummies. so there was a movement to say, let's make this small male female like so they put a rest of vinyl jacket on it. it doesn't make it a female. this neglecting car crash, testing and car design has had real life consequences. the national highway traffic safety administration in the us has identified increased safety risks for women in most areas of the body. there's been modifications to a male stand to try to say she's a female. but if you look at the actual injury, it's an address what the injuries are that are different between a male and a female. and there's many, there's still a lot more that can be done. and this is why a specially purpose designed female crash test dummy is vital right now. so in
5:37 am
2024, they are still using the shrunken mailed dummy as a female representation. all those things that. ready you know, are different, dizzy, logically, from a man in a woman, she has not been incorporated into the crash test dummies. nora hard even the scale down male being used behind the wheel hard. in recent years, more advanced female crash test dummies have been developed. addressing the needs of female occupants, including differences in next strength, hip anatomy and pelvis, structure. one model down the average email is the set 50 s designed by researchers at the sweetest national road and transport research institute. the average p. my model is developed specifically for low, severe to green, said 50 f stands for a seat evaluation to of female and 50 is the median value for the height of
5:38 am
a real woman. this was created alongside a male version set 50. the stats are designed to evaluate the safety performance of car seats in low severity rear impact and also show how these affects the female and male body differently. another model is the story a 5 f and advanced female frontal impact. i mean, that corresponds with the 5th percentile of the female population. they were designed with actual female answer permits read data, ensuring a form distinct from its male version human that accessed the originator of crash test dummies. their origins can be traced back to the fifty's and samuel alderson who created the 1st to crash test dummies, sierra sam for testing aircraft safety systems. this groundbreaking technology paid the way for developing automotive crash test dummies ever since. you haven't had
5:39 am
accessed since become the largest maker of gummies, producing a wide range of models and the 4 or 5 that looks to address the biggest risks for women. a 54 percent of fatalities are associated with the frontal crashes. the so are 5 s. boasts 150 sensor channel, a strategically placed to address areas where women are more susceptible to injury in front of the car crashes. as with the set, 50 f, it offers a promising solution, tackling different caps and safety testing for women. it's important to know the us and to europe have different testing agencies and standards. vehicle safety testing in the us is regulated by the national highway traffic safety administration and the insurance institute for highway safety in europe, the european new car assessment program independently evaluate safety, with similar crash tests and all use a star rating system. but neither use
5:40 am
a female crash test dummies, intern frontal impact test. so that 5 star rated car you're driving might not be as safe as you think. depending who is behind the wheel. people just assumed when they go into a car dealership and they are asking for the gun counter 5 star cars with regards to crash safety. they do not presume that is meant only for one sets. there are still 1350000 fatalities globally with the u. s. boasting $43000.00 paid salaries. so there's plenty of room for improvement. so even if the entire world says we're, we need this tomorrow, it can take years. it's kind of like introducing a medical product into the marketplace. it takes years to go through and f d, a approval. the crest as dummies have a similar process. as a consequence,
5:41 am
we see these disparities and injuries that can happen for years and years before a test device is provided into the marketplace. but there are signs of change on the horizon. bureau and cap has suggested it will introduce the thor 5 half by 2030 and in a world 1st, mercedes used to eaves in a public crash test travelling at 56 kilometers an hour to simulate a higher energy collision is a milestone of all development vision is 0 fatal accidents in 2050 for us for everybody here that approaches to make the road traffic safer for everybody? one big thing to note is the test used email dummies in the driver's seat, emphasizing the focus on creating protection systems for a broad customer base. a currently new female models are still not used by
5:42 am
regulators, but they're not the only answer. ritual testing and simulations also play a prominent role in the future of car safety. these virtual models will complement physical crash tests, allowing car makers to conduct a wider range of evaluations cost effectively. but they need authentic data. we all know with the dangers of artificial intelligence that it depends on the data that's put in. so if you don't have data with regard to the safety of a crash test dummies that is bias a del, a, to a female. your data is going to be skewed from the get. the new cars have already seen decreased disparities in car crashes between genders and h t. s. a found the difference in female fatality risk compared to mail is reduced in newer vehicles from 18 percent to $6.00. i think the,
5:43 am
the folks who want to resist change are trying to use fatalities for a benefit of say, we don't need to do more or because the difference between a female and a male in a fatality isn't that great. but when you look at the injuries, it's significant, the difference between a male and a female in injuries is cataclysmic. and we're seeing those injuries going. as consumers become more aware of the issue with crash test diversity, could this impact car companies directly? women are buying more cars and driving more cars and then it's still so the use and the practicality is there. unfortunately, the depth and serious injuries numbers aren't there. and we can't solve it by just talking about it. we all know that auto see the is the number one reason the majority of the world buys a vehicle. so safety is not a marketing gimmick. it's
5:44 am
a requirement, and whoever continues to advanced safety, i think we'll get more and more market share. the vision 0 approach aiming for 0 traffic may tell it is, will continue to gain momentum as an overarching goal for road safety. if the community is really after 0 fatalities in reducing the increasing of injuries that were constantly see, we have to do more. and so if we're measuring one size of 50 is percentile male and the driver seat, it minimizes the use of adaptable restrictions. and by putting in a female and a male in the driver's seat, it's one step closer. can new e v brands from the likes of trying to push the industry to address gender bias? really clearly that of a car company comes out and can assure consumers that there's a safety standard that is beneficial to both women and that there would be a market driven push for other car companies. to do that,
5:45 am
i think we will see china in the next 5 to 10 years, take leadership rules and, and introducing safety protocols to the marketplace. especially as the electric vehicles in a levels of autonomy vehicle become more of a norm efforts are under way to change the status quote from historical reliance on male centric models to the introduction of females crash test dummies like this or 5 and said 50 a. but the journey is ongoing, with regulatory bodies still needing a female dummy in frontal impact test. as electric vehicles reshape the industry, a new players from china emerge. the push for gender inclusive safety gains, momentum. 2 the difference in craft test outcomes has real world impacts for women . in a safety focused world, the past towards vision 0 must be an inclusive one. the
